Top 5 2D Anime Games in Oceania Q4 2025: Unified Platform Insights
Explore the performance trends of the top 2D anime games in Oceania during Q4 2025 on a unified platform, featuring insights from Sensor Tower.
In the fourth quarter of 2025, the top 2D anime games on a unified platform in Oceania displayed diverse performance trends. Here's an overview based on Sensor Tower data.
MapleStory : Idle RPG by NEXON Company saw a significant rise in we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$134.8K by the last week of November. Downloads fluctuated, with a high of 7.2K in mid-November. Active users showed a steady increase, reaching around 10.6K by the end of December.
Hero Wars: Alliance Fantasy from Nexters Global LTD maintained a consistent revenue stream, with a peak of $57K in late December. Downloads surged from 1.7K at the start of the quarter to 4.8K by the end. Active users grew steadily, closing the quarter at about 15.7K.
Chaos Zero Nightmare by Smilegate, Inc. experienced varied revenue, with a high of $72.6K in late October. Downloads and active users both trended downward, ending the quarter with 536 downloads and approximately 2.3K active users.
Arknights from YOSTAR LIMITED had a notable revenue peak of $100.6K in mid-October. Downloads remained stable around 300 weekly, while active users hovered near 870 for most of the quarter.
Finally, DRAGON BALL Z DOKKAN BATTLE by Bandai Namco Entertainment Inc. showed a revenue spike to $67.1K in the last week of December. Downloads increased gradually, reaching 448 weekly, while active users remained consistent, ending the quarter with approximately 11.6K.
